MargaretSIMPSONMargaret Eveline Simpson - nee Wright - (February 1944 to February 2026)
We are sad to announce the passing of our sister Margaret Eveline Simpson, known as Maggie (nee Wright).
Maggie passed away peacefully at The Royal Devon and Exeter Hospital, Wonford, on Saturday 28th of February 2026 at 9.50 am.

Daughter of Sam and Joyce Wright, hairdresser, of Alphington Street, St. Thomas, Exeter.
Sister to Terry and Frances, wife of the late Graham, aunty to Theresa, Sandra, Karen, Helen, Timothy and Jonathan.
A friend to the Riverside Church, St. Thomas, her neighbours from Hamlin Gardens and others throughout Exeter where Maggie lived all her life, she is greatly missed by all.

The funeral service will be conducted by Pastor Aran Richardson of the Riverside Church on
Friday the 20th of March at 11:30 am at Exeter and Devon Crematorium, St. Peter's Chapel.

Donations will be shared between 'Exeter & District Kidney Patients Association' and 'Exeter Street Pastors' and can be sent directly to M. Sillifant and Sons of 19-20 Holloway Street, Exeter, or by retiring collection at the Crematorium service, or online at https://maggiesimpson.muchloved.com
